Speech and writing of an autistic

The article discusses the controversy surrounding the writing methods used by individuals with limited speech, focusing on Woody Brown, a minimally verbal autistic man who graduated from UCLA and wrote a novel titled 'Upward Bound' with his mother's assistance. The piece highlights the debate around the Rapid Prompting Method (RPM), which has been criticized for potentially allowing facilitators to influence the content of the writings. It references the earlier Contaminated Communication technique and notes that research consistently shows facilitators can control the output. The article criticizes the New York Times for promoting Brown’s work, suggesting it may have contributed to the book's success while raising questions about the authenticity of the writing process.
